CommencerCommencer gratuitement

Combiner i, j et by (I)

Dans cet exercice, vous allez combiner les arguments i, j et by pour trouver la première et la dernière course pour chaque station de départ. Rappelez-vous que data.table filtre d’abord les lignes dans i, puis regroupe les lignes avec by, et enfin calcule l’expression dans j.

Cet exercice fait partie du cours

Manipulation de données avec data.table en R

Afficher le cours

Instructions

  • Triez batrips selon la colonne start_date par ordre croissant.
  • Regroupez les lignes par start_station.
  • Extrayez la première et la dernière lignes de start_date.

Exercice interactif pratique

Essayez cet exercice en complétant cet exemple de code.

# Find the first and last ride for each start_station
first_last <- batrips[___, 
                      .(start_date = ___), 
                      by = ___]
first_last
Modifier et exécuter le code